发明名称 HEAT EXCHANGE DEVICE WITH RING SHAPED THIN SLIT SECTION FOR USE IN LIQUID ADHESIVE SYSTEMS AND RELATED METHODS
摘要 A heat exchange device for heating liquid adhesive material to an application temperature suitable for an adhesive bonding application includes a body having an inlet configured to receive a flow of liquid adhesive material and an outlet configured to provide the liquid adhesive material to a dispensing device for the adhesive bonding application. A fluid passageway in the body connects the inlet and the outlet. The fluid passageway includes a thin slit section in the form of an elongated ring shape, having a length along a fluid flow direction between the inlet and the outlet, the thin slit section further having a first dimension and a second dimension transverse to the fluid flow direction. The first dimension and the length are substantially greater than the second dimension. The heat exchange device further includes a heating element for heating the liquid adhesive material flowing through the thin slit section.

主权项 1. A heat exchange device for heating liquid adhesive material to an application temperature suitable for an adhesive bonding application, comprising: a body having an inlet configured to receive a flow of liquid adhesive material and an outlet configured to provide the liquid adhesive material to a dispensing device for the adhesive bonding application, a fluid passageway defined in said body connecting said inlet and said outlet and configured to receive the flow of liquid adhesive material, said fluid passageway including a thin slit section having a length along a fluid flow direction between said inlet and said outlet, said thin slit section further having a first dimension and a second dimension transverse to the fluid flow direction, the first dimension and the length being substantially greater than the second dimension, wherein a profile of said thin slit section is a ring, the first dimension is a circumference of the ring, and the second dimension is a radial thickness of the ring, and at least one heating element thermally coupled with said body and configured for heating the liquid adhesive material flowing through said fluid passageway to the application temperature.
